POLLACHIUS, proper noun. A taxonomic genus within the family Gadidae — the pollocks.
POLLACHIUS POLLACHIUS, proper noun. A taxonomic species within the family Gadidae — the European pollock.
POLLACHIUS VIRENS, proper noun. A taxonomic species within the family Gadidae.
